1 1910 United States Federal Census, Richland Township, Venango County, PA, Enumeration District 141, Page 9, lines 43-48 lists John A. Kline, 53, married to Ella Kline, 45. They live with four children: daughter Winni Kline, 22; daughter Gladys Kline, 19; son Frederick Kline, 12; and daughter Mary Kline, 6. John and Ella Kline are listed as having been married for 25 years. Ella Kline has given birth to five children, all of whom are still living. Everyone and their parents were born in PA. John A. Kline is listed as a farmer and Frederick Kline is listed as a laborer, both of whom work on the family farm. Everyone can read, write, and speak English. Frederick Kline and Mary Kline attended school within the census year. This census is dated 30 Apr 1910 - 2 May 1910.

17 Obituary of Mary P. Fillgrove, from collection of Margaret Kahle, original source not known, possibly Oil City Derrick.
6 Jan 1987 Mary Philista (Kline) Fillgrove, age 83, died Tuesday at the home of her son in Oil City. Born 13 Aug 1903 in Richland Twp., Venango Co., PA, the daughter of John Abrahm Kline and Ann Elizabeth Frederick Kline. Married Harold Lewis Fillgrove in 1920. He died in June 1968. Survived by a son: John L. Fillgrove of Oil City, nine grandchildren and 3 great grandchildren. She was preceded in death by her husband, two sons: KArl and Stanley (Butch); three sisters: Annie (Mrs. Austin) Sheffer, Winnie (Mrs. Elgie) Beals, and Gladys (Mrs. Otis) Sheffer; and a brother: Frederick Kline. Criswell-Gardinier Funeral Home is making arrangements. Mrs. Fillgrove was a homemaker. She was a member of Salem Lutheran church and president of the Lutheran Council of Women and of the women's auxillary to the DeHart-Rossman American Legion. She graduated from East Home HS and attended Slippery Rock Normal School. Funeral is 2 pm in Salem Lutheran Church, Rev. Thomas Prosser, pastor of Edenburg Presbyterian Church will Officiate. Burial in Salem Lutheran Cemetery.
